Abstract: A variable displacement axial piston pump has a plurality of piston bores each connected to an inwardly angled fill port. The fill ports extend from the piston bores inwardly to the working face of the barrel to reduce the diameter of the fill circle of a pump. This decreases the velocity that must be attained by incoming fluid to thereby increase the operating speed at which the pump may be driven where the pump is filled at atmospheric pressure.
